Advantage Alpha Capital Partners LP lifted its position in shares of Floor & Decor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:FND - Free Report) by 33.8% during the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 38,780 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 9,807 shares during the period. Advantage Alpha Capital Partners LP's holdings in Floor & Decor were worth $3,121,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Floor & Decor Trading Down 1.3%
FND stock opened at $80.8790 on Friday. The company has a quick ratio of 0.28, a current ratio of 1.25 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.08. Floor & Decor Holdings, Inc. has a twelve month low of $66.01 and a twelve month high of $124.68. The stock has a market capitalization of $8.71 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 41.48,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 3.52 and a beta of 1.68. The firm's fifty day simple moving average is $79.57 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$80.84.
Floor & Decor (NYSE:FND -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, July 31st. The company reported $0.58 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.57 by $0.01. Floor & Decor had a net margin of 4.59% and a return on equity of 9.36%. The firm had revenue of $1.21 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.21 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the firm earned $0.52 earnings per share. The business's revenue was up 7.2% on a year-over-year basis. Floor & Decor has set its FY 2025 guidance at 1.750-2.000 EPS. As a group, analysts anticipate that Floor & Decor Holdings, Inc. will post 2 earnings per share for the current year.

Floor & Decor Profile

Floor & Decor Holdings, Inc engages in the retail of hard surface flooring and related accessories. It provides wood, stone, and flooring products. Its products include vinyl, laminate, and tiles with materials installation for living rooms, kitchen, bathrooms, and walls. The company was founded by George Vincent West in 2000 and is headquartered in Atlanta, GA.
